Senior Computer Engineer

KIHOMAC · Oklahoma City, OK

Lead electronics development, testing, and fabrication including coordination with sub-tier suppliers Develop and review technical data packages, including drawings, schematics, netlists and Gerber files Develop test and quality procedures for verification and validation of electronic products Support lab testing and quality inspection of electronic products Support implementation and oversight of rework and repair processes for electronic products Work in integrated product teams of diverse technical disciplines Perform technical analysis associated with signal, power, FPGA and other types of systems Develop technical procedures, instructions, materials, reports and other documentation to support product development, manufacturing, rework and repair of electronic products Exercise judgment on assigned tasks and provide recommendations on technical component design, adaptation, alternatives or selection to meet requirements Support validation of electronic systems specifications Perform PFMEA, RCCA, and FRACAS analysis and implement process or design improvements Support research and development activities Other duties as assigned Requirements Education/Training:   Bachelor’s Degree in relevant engineering or science discipline required  Computer Engineering or equivalent  Experience: 5+ years of professional experience in the required task area Required skills: Experience in the design, build, and test of multi-layer Printed Circuit Boards with processor, memory, and standard I/O Proficient in the use of Electronic CAD tools to implement schematics, layout, parts selection, and detailed PCB design Proficient in the use of Lab Equipment such as DVM, Oscilloscopes & soldering tools Familiarity with IPC standards: IPC-7711/7721, A-600, 610, 620, CC-830, J-STD-001 Preferred skills: Experience with OrCAD, Allegro, and KiCAD Experience with MIL-STD-810, MIL-STD-461, and MIL-STD-464 Security: Must be a US citizen Ability to obtain a security clearance may be required Physical Requirements: Able to occasionally reach with hands and arms Prolonged periods of computer screen use, while sitting or standing at a desk Adhere to safety protocols when in work areas requiring use of PPE (e.g. eyewear, gloves, masks, hearing protection, steel toed shoes, etc.) Able to safely lift and carry up to 20 pounds at a time Benefits Health Care Plan (Medical, Dental & Vision) Retirement Plan (401k, IRA) Life Insurance (Basic, Voluntary & AD&D) Paid Time Off (Vacation, Sick & Public Holidays) Short Term & Long Term Disability Training & Development Wellness Resources Salary:  $110,000 - 120,000 This is not a guarantee of compensation, rather actual salary will be based on experience, qualifications, and applicable certifications or degrees held. Offered salary may fall outside of this range.
